× Well, chatting is one of the obligation of the people in all over the world because from chatting we can, uh, connect with other people even we far away from them.
✓ Well, chatting is one of the obligations of the people all over the world because from chatting we can, uh, connect with other people even when we are far away from them.
The word 'obligation' should be plural 'obligations' because it refers to one among many obligations. Also, 'even we far away' is missing 'when' and the verb 'are' to form a correct clause 'even when we are far away'.
× So I always do chatting with my friend, with my parents when I'm away.
✓ So I always chat with my friends and my parents when I'm away.
The phrase 'do chatting' is incorrect; the verb 'chat' should be used directly. Also, 'friend' should be plural 'friends' to match the context of chatting with multiple people.
× Well I did check many kind of chat with my friend but one of the most chat that I remember was talking about my friend a job.
✓ Well, I did have many kinds of chats with my friends but one of the chats that I remember most was talking about my friend's job.
The phrase 'did check' is incorrect; 'did have' or 'had' is appropriate. 'Many kind' should be 'many kinds' to be plural. 'Chat' should be plural 'chats'. 'My friend a job' should be 'my friend's job' to show possession.
× So he want to ask me something about this job it is sweet or not.
✓ So he wants to ask me something about this job, whether it is good or not.
The verb 'want' should be 'wants' to agree with the third person singular subject 'he'. Also, 'it is sweet or not' is awkward; 'whether it is good or not' is clearer.
× So I give an explain.
✓ So I gave an explanation.
The phrase 'give an explain' is incorrect; the correct noun form is 'explanation' and the past tense verb 'gave' matches the past context.
